Dutch Baby Apple Pancake

Ingredients

½ cup halved
3 large eggs
½ teaspoon vanilla extract
6 tablespoons melted unsalted butter
½ cup all-purpose flour
¼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on cinnamon
3 tablespoons light brown sugar
2 tablespoons lemon juice
2 Granny Smith apples, peeled, cored and sliced
¼ cup chopped walnuts, optional
Powdered sugar optional

To make


Preheat the oven to 375°F. Whisk the eggs, vanilla and 2 tablespoons of butter in a blender until smooth. Combine flour, salt, and 1/4 teaspoon cinnamon.In a 10-inch nonstick skillet, combine the remaining butter and cinnamon with the brown sugar and lemon juice.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at, stirring occasionally. Add the apples, reduce the heat to low, and simmer, stirring frequently, until the apples are soft and the liquid thickens, about 7 minutes.Pour the batter from the blender over the apple mixture; sprinkle with nuts if desired. Bake until the dough is lightly browned, 25 to 30 minutes. If desired, sprinkle with powdered sugar.
